Woman jealous of boyfriend's 'bromance' stabs his best friend

WARNING - distressing content: A mum has been jailed after she slashed her boyfriend's best mate's neck with a knife - because she was jealous of their bromance.

Jodie Goodwin, 20, narrowly missed vital blood vessels and arteries in Anthony Milburn's neck when she lunged at his throat with a knife, it was claimed.

The UK mum-of-one was furious with then-partner Andrew, who said he and his friend were going to a house party after a night in the pub.

She armed herself with a 14cm-long kitchen knife and lunged at Anthony, 27, inflicting a 4cm-deep wound circling his neck, which needed 16 stitches, he said.

Goodwin admitted to wounding without intent and was told she was lucky to avoid facing a murder charge by a judge who jailed her for 27 months.

Anthony, a roofer and father-of-two, who has revealed the scar, said: "My best mate's girlfriend could have killed me - all because she was jealous.

"Me and Andrew were having a good laugh so when I found out a friend was having a house party nearby I said 'Let's go'.

"Jodie had a face like thunder and hissed 'You're not going with him'.

Newcastle Crown Court heard all three had been out drinking in February 2016 before they returned to Goodwin's house in Cambois, Northumberland.

The court heard she was "jealous of the close friendship he had with her boyfriend" and had openly voiced her dislike for him in the past.

Speaking after the case, Anthony said she had been jealous of his friendship with her then-partner, and became angry when he suggested they go to a party.

Jessica Slaughter, prosecuting, told the court she "leaned forward and slashed his neck".

Goodwin was arrested later that day and initially claimed it had been an accident which happened while she was cutting pizza.

The court heard she then falsely claimed Anthony had made sexual advances towards her.

Sentencing her in October, Mr Recorder Wheeler said Anthony was "lucky to survive".

Ian Hudson, mitigating, said it was a "drunken, spontaneous act" and Goodwin, had matured since having a baby.
